Zachary Chirazi

Director of Recreation and Micro Soccer

Zak’s deep understanding of youth soccer and his dedication and commitment to player development makes him the ideal candidate to step into this role.  He is a determined worker and a highly likable and respected coach within the soccer community, and Seals are excited for the impact he will have in shaping the Seals Recreational soccer program.


Before coming back to the Seals, he was coaching as the Assistant Coach of CSU Monterey Bay's men's team. In addition to his coaching role with CSU Monterey, Zak was part of the administrative staff and managed operations and logistics for travel games and tournaments - among many other responsibilities! He has been coaching teams of all ages and competitive levels ranging from recreational micro teams to intercollegiate varsity level for the past 10+ years. Coach Zak has been the assistant coach of San Jose Earthquakes' U14 boys pre-academy first and second teams as well as San Jose State Men's Varsity team. He coaches clinics and camps for Liverpool Football Club's International American Academy (2015-2016) and Stanford University Men's Soccer Camps since 2014.


Coach Zak holds the NSCAA National Level Diploma, USSF E License, Fiorentina NorCal Level 1 Certification, and is also NCAA Recruiting Test Certified. He also holds a Bachelor's degree in Communication Studies from San Jose State University.
